项目摘要
As concern for environmental stewardship rises, and the ecological and monetary expense of chemical inputs rises beyond societal thresholds, organic agricultural practices may become more and more important in western Canada, as they have in much of Europe. There have been few long-term studies on spring wheat production under organic conditions in Canada, and especially in the black soil zone of the Canadian Prairies. The proposed research is a continuation of a pioneering long-term NSERC Discovery Grant supported program related to the development of breeding and agronomic strategies for the organic production of wheat.
